Palpur

Palpur is a village located in Nagina tehsil of Bijnor district in Uttar Pradesh, India. It is situated 11km away from sub-district headquarter Nagina (tehsildar office) and 44km away from district headquarter Bijnor. As per 2009 stats, Ishlamabad is the gram panchayat of Palpur village.

About Palpur

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Palpur is 113018. The village spans a total geographical area of 103.91 hectares. Nagina is nearest town to Palpur village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 11km away.

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Palpur village:

  • The total population of Palpur village is around 20, including approximately 13 males and 7 females, with a sex ratio of 538 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 2 children aged 0–6 years in Palpur village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• The literacy rate of Palpur village is about 60.00%, with male literacy at 76.92% and female literacy at 28.57%.
  • There are around 3 households in Palpur village.
